In structural analysis, simplifying a complex load distribution to a single force acting at a specific point is a fundamental concept. Consider a beam supporting the weight of a wall. Instead of analyzing the force exerted by each brick individually, the overall effect of the wall’s weight can be represented by a single downward force acting at the wall’s centroid. This simplification facilitates calculations of reactions at supports and internal stresses within the beam.
This process offers significant advantages in structural engineering design and analysis. It reduces computational complexity, making analyses more manageable, especially in complex structures. This simplification allows engineers to focus on the overall structural behavior without getting bogged down in intricate load distribution details. Historically, this method has been essential, enabling analysis of complex structures even before the advent of sophisticated computational tools. It remains a cornerstone of modern structural engineering practice, providing a clear and efficient way to understand structural behavior.
Consistency in medication regimens is crucial for achieving optimal therapeutic outcomes. Irregular dosage can lead to suboptimal drug levels in the body, potentially hindering the effectiveness of the treatment and increasing the risk of adverse effects or complications. For example, antibiotics require consistent dosing to maintain sufficient levels to eradicate the targeted bacteria. Inconsistent intake can lead to antibiotic resistance, rendering the medication ineffective. Similarly, medications for chronic conditions like hypertension or diabetes must be taken regularly to maintain stable physiological control and prevent long-term complications.
The benefits of adherence to prescribed medication schedules are numerous. Proper adherence maximizes therapeutic effectiveness, minimizes the risk of disease progression or complications, and improves overall patient outcomes. This minimally invasive cosmetic procedure involves using a device containing tiny needles to create controlled micro-injuries in the skin. These micro-injuries stimulate collagen and elastin production, promoting skin rejuvenation. The addition of platelet-rich plasma (PRP), derived from the patient’s own blood, further enhances the treatment by providing a concentrated source of growth factors that accelerate healing and amplify the regenerative effects. This combination aims to improve skin texture, reduce the appearance of wrinkles, scars, and hyperpigmentation, and promote a more youthful complexion.
The potential for enhanced skin rejuvenation through the synergistic action of collagen stimulation and growth factor application makes this combination therapy an increasingly popular option. It offers a relatively natural approach to addressing various skin concerns with minimal downtime compared to more invasive procedures. While a relatively recent development in aesthetic medicine, it builds upon established principles of wound healing and regenerative medicine, leveraging the body’s natural mechanisms for improved outcomes.

Contrasting a character array (often used to represent strings in C/C++) directly with a string literal can lead to unpredictable outcomes. For instance, `char myArray[] = “hello”;` declares a character array. Attempting to compare this array directly with another string literal, such as `if (myArray == “hello”)`, compares memory addresses, not the string content. This is because `myArray` decays to a pointer in this context. The comparison might coincidentally evaluate to true in some instances (e.g., the compiler might reuse the same memory location for identical literals within a function), but this behavior isn’t guaranteed and may change across compilers or optimization levels. Correct string comparison requires using functions like `strcmp()` from the standard library.
Ensuring predictable program behavior relies on understanding the distinction between pointer comparison and string content comparison. Direct comparison of character arrays with string literals can introduce subtle bugs that are difficult to track, especially in larger projects or when code is recompiled under different conditions. Correct string comparison methodologies contribute to robust, portable, and maintainable software. Historically, this issue has arisen due to the way C/C++ handle character arrays and string literals. Prior to the widespread adoption of standard string classes (like `std::string` in C++), working with strings frequently involved direct manipulation of character arrays, leading to potential pitfalls for those unfamiliar with the nuances of pointer arithmetic and string representation in memory.
